Turning Point Secondary School – Precision Metal Manufacturing II
Mar 2026 · 2nd Semester
Students will build on the manual machining skills gained in Precision Metal Manufacturing I as they move into the use of Computer Numerical Control (CNC) machining. They will study various CNC systems to differentiate the development and implementation of those systems, learn the process planning and tool selection within a CNC lab environment, learn to operate a CNC lathe and CNC mill, manually program a CNC lathe and a CNC mill, and understand and implement quality control procedures.
Prerequisites: Precision Metal Manufacturing I
Grades: Grade 11, Grade 12
